Originally posted by Xenthar
I just thought i'd share. A guy on the g35 forums just finished the install and it had some pretty good gains for no upgraded engine modifications except for exhausts. He dynoed 232 wrhp and 216 torque before the install and now he has 345rwhp and 375 torque (WOW!). Heres the website with all his pics. I'm just so much in awe. I wished i had the money to turbo my G too

http://www.chrisbruceloans.com/g35/g35.htm
After tuning they can do even 420 at the wheels. We have a guy here with one.
